I saw on the news early today that sony basically pulled the plug on itself after learning that the personal information of their customers as well as their employees was at risk. they said sony would soon be sending out emails to over 70 million customers whos personal information was comprimised as a result of the attack. they also went on to say that one sony spokesman said it could be a couple weeks before all sony services are reinstated.. sounds like a mess to me =(

http://www.cnn.com/2011/TECH/gaming....iref=allsearch

Apparently the above attack led to an investigation that uncovered a hole in sony's security thus they pulled the plug on the whole sony gaming network
